excel筛选为什么不能排序
作者:路由通
|
232人看过
发布时间:2026-01-04 13:44:33
标签:
在日常使用电子表格软件时,许多用户会遇到筛选后无法正常排序的困扰。这并非软件缺陷,而是源于筛选功能和排序功能在设计逻辑与数据处理机制上的本质差异。筛选操作会隐藏不符合条件的行,形成数据的子集视图,而排序则需要基于完整连续的数据序列进行操作。理解这两个功能的底层原理、掌握正确的操作顺序以及识别常见的操作误区,是解决这一问题的关键。本文将深入解析十二个核心维度,帮助用户彻底掌握电子表格中筛选与排序的协同工作逻辑。
作为一款功能强大的电子表格软件,其筛选和排序功能是数据处理中最常被使用的工具之一。然而,许多用户,尤其是初学者,常常会遇到一个令人困惑的情况:对数据进行筛选后,尝试对筛选结果进行排序,却发现操作不如预期,甚至完全无法执行。这背后涉及的是软件底层数据处理逻辑的深刻原理。本文将从一个资深编辑的视角,系统性地剖析这一现象,揭示其背后的十二个关键原因,并提供实用的解决方案。
一、功能本质的根本性差异:视图操作与数据重构 筛选和排序虽然都是对数据集的整理手段,但它们的本质截然不同。筛选功能本质上是一种“视图操作”。它根据用户设定的条件,暂时隐藏那些不符合条件的行,只显示满足条件的行。这个过程并不改变原始数据的物理存储顺序,也不改变数据之间的内在联系,只是改变了用户屏幕上看到的数据子集。而排序功能则是一种“数据重构操作”。它会实际改变数据行在表格中的物理位置,按照指定的关键字(如数值大小、字母顺序、日期先后)重新排列所有数据行(在筛选状态下,通常是针对可见行)。当筛选激活时,软件操作的是数据的“子集视图”,而排序通常期望作用于“完整数据集”,这种操作对象的不匹配是导致问题发生的根本原因之一。微软官方帮助文档明确指出,筛选后的排序行为可能与未筛选时有别,提示用户注意操作环境。二、操作顺序的逻辑优先性:先排序后筛选的最佳实践 一个非常重要却被许多用户忽视的原则是操作顺序。正确的操作顺序应该是“先排序,后筛选”。首先对完整的数据集进行排序,确保所有数据按照你的主要需求(例如,按日期从新到旧)排列整齐。然后,再应用筛选条件,从已排序的数据中提取出你需要的特定子集。这样做,筛选结果自然会保持之前排序的层次结构。如果顺序颠倒,先筛选后排序,那么排序操作只能在你当前可见的、已被筛选过的数据子集内进行,这可能会导致一些意想不到的结果,比如总体顺序的混乱,或者无法按照你期望的全局关键字进行排序。三、隐藏行的处理机制:排序的盲区 当筛选功能隐藏了某些行后,这些行虽然不可见,但它们依然存在于工作表中。标准的排序功能在设计上,默认只对“可见单元格”进行操作。这意味着,那些被筛选条件隐藏起来的行,在排序过程中通常会被忽略,它们会保持原有的位置不变。这就产生了一个矛盾:你希望的是对所有数据(包括隐藏的)按照某种逻辑重新整体排列,但软件执行的是对可见部分的重排。结果就是,当你取消筛选后,可能会发现整个数据表的顺序变得杂乱无章,因为可见部分被重排了,而隐藏部分却原地不动,破坏了数据整体的连贯性。四、混合数据类型的列:排序规则的内在冲突 有时,即使没有应用筛选,在某些列上排序也会出现问题。一个常见的原因是列中混合了不同的数据类型。例如,一列中既包含数字(如100、250),又包含文本(如“待定”、“暂无”)。软件对这类列的排序规则可能存在歧义。在筛选状态下,这个问题可能会被放大。软件可能无法确定是按照数字顺序还是文本字母顺序进行排序,从而导致排序失败或结果混乱。确保需要排序的列数据类型统一,是避免此类问题的基础。五、单元格格式的不一致性:表面现象背后的陷阱 与数据类型类似,单元格格式的不一致也会干扰排序操作。例如,有些日期看起来一样,但一些被格式化为真正的“日期”格式,另一些则可能被存储为“文本”格式。在筛选后,对这样的列进行排序,文本格式的“日期”和真正的日期会被区别对待,导致排序结果不符合时间先后逻辑。同样,数字若被格式为文本,排序时就会按字符逐个比较,而不是数值大小,例如“100”可能会排在“2”的前面。在操作前,统一关键列的单元格格式至关重要。六、合并单元格的存在:数据结构的破坏者 合并单元格在视觉上很美观,但对于数据处理功能(尤其是筛选和排序)来说,往往是灾难性的。如果尝试对包含合并单元格的区域进行筛选后排序,软件很可能会报错或产生不可预料的结果。因为排序需要明确每一行的独立性和可移动性,而合并单元格破坏了标准的行、列网格结构。涉及排序操作的数据区域,应尽量避免使用合并单元格。七、数据区域选择的不完整性:模糊的边界定义 如果数据区域没有被正确定义为一个完整的“表格”(使用“插入表格”功能)或没有通过选中整个连续区域来明确范围,软件可能无法智能识别所有需要参与排序的数据。在筛选状态下,这个问题的表现可能更微妙。你可能以为自己排序的是整个筛选结果,但实际上软件操作的可能只是其中一部分连续区域,而漏掉了边缘的一些行。最佳实践是先将数据区域转换为正式的“表格”对象,这样软件就能自动管理数据范围,确保操作的一致性。八、标题行的识别错误:被误判的数据行 排序功能需要明确区分标题行和数据行。如果软件错误地将标题行(通常是第一行)判断为数据的一部分,或者在筛选后,由于某些行的隐藏,导致标题行标识丢失或混乱,排序操作就可能出错。例如,它可能尝试对标题文本进行“升序”或“降序”排列,这显然不是用户的本意。确保在排序对话框中勾选“数据包含标题”选项(如果确实有标题),可以避免此类问题。九、多级排序的复杂性:层级逻辑在筛选下的失效 多级排序(例如,先按部门排序,部门相同的再按工资排序)是一种强大的数据组织方式。然而,在筛选状态下应用多级排序需要格外小心。筛选操作已经根据条件提取了一个子集,这个子集内部的数据关系可能与完整数据集不同。在子集内应用多级排序,其“主关键字”的有效范围可能已经改变,导致排序结果无法反映全局的层级关系。用户需要重新评估在当前筛选视图下,哪些排序关键字仍然是合理且有意义的。十、软件版本与设置的差异性:环境因素的影响 不同版本的电子表格软件,或者同一版本下的不同设置,可能会影响筛选后排序的行为。虽然核心逻辑保持一致,但在细节处理、错误提示和默认选项上可能存在细微差别。例如,某些版本可能对部分隐藏行的处理更为严格。了解自己所使用软件版本的特性和相关设置选项,有助于更准确地预测操作结果。十一、外部链接与公式的依赖性:动态数据的连锁反应 如果工作表中的数据包含大量引用其他工作表或工作簿的公式,或者在排序后其值会发生变化的公式(例如使用`随机数`函数或`当前行`函数),那么在筛选后排序可能会引发一系列连锁计算。这不仅可能导致排序结果不稳定(每次操作结果不同),还可能因为重新计算而降低性能,甚至产生引用错误。在处理这类动态数据时,需要特别谨慎,有时可能需要先将公式结果转换为静态数值后再进行操作。十二、理解“排序左边”的限制:视野之外的考量 这是一个相对高级但重要的问题。当你在一个经过筛选的表中,如果选择某一列进行排序,软件通常会弹出对话框,询问你是“仅排序此列”还是“扩展选定区域”。如果错误地选择了“仅排序此列”,那么只有你选中的这一列的数据顺序会被打乱,而其他列的数据保持不动。这将彻底破坏数据行的完整性,导致一行中的数据彼此错位。在筛选状态下,由于部分行不可见,这种错误操作带来的后果可能更难以立即发现和修复。务必选择“扩展选定区域”,以确保整行数据作为一个整体移动。实用解决方案与总结 面对筛选后排序的挑战,用户可以采取以下策略:首先,养成“先排序,后筛选”的良好习惯。其次,在处理数据前,进行数据清洗,确保数据类型统一、格式一致、没有合并单元格。第三,优先使用“表格”功能来管理数据区域,它能提供更稳定和智能的行为。第四,在进行任何重要排序操作前,最好先备份原始数据。最后,深入理解每个功能背后的逻辑,而不仅仅是记住操作步骤,这样才能在面对复杂情况时灵活应对。 总而言之,“电子表格筛选后不能顺利排序”并非一个简单的错误,而是两个强大功能在特定交互场景下内在逻辑差异的体现。通过理解上述十二个层面的原因,用户不仅能够解决眼前的问题,更能提升对电子表格数据处理逻辑的整体认知,从而更加高效和精准地驾驭数据。
相关文章
本文深入解析电子表格打印时边框消失的十二个关键因素。从页面布局设置到打印参数配置,从视图模式差异到文档格式兼容性问题,全面剖析边框显示异常的技术原理。结合官方操作指南和实际案例,提供逐步排查方案和预防措施,帮助用户彻底解决打印输出无边框的困扰,确保文档呈现专业效果。
2026-01-04 13:44:28
142人看过
本文将深入解析电子表格软件中下拉填充功能出现连续数字"1"的十六种成因及解决方案,涵盖单元格格式设置、填充序列模式、公式引用逻辑等核心技术要点,并提供官方操作指引和实用技巧,帮助用户彻底解决此类数据填充异常问题。
2026-01-04 13:44:27
387人看过
当用户下载Excel文件后默认使用WPS打开的情况,通常源于操作系统文件关联设置、办公软件兼容性机制及用户安装行为等多重因素共同作用。本文将从技术原理、软件交互、用户设置等维度深入解析这一现象,帮助读者理解底层逻辑并掌握自主控制文件打开方式的实用技巧,有效解决日常办公中的文件关联困扰。
2026-01-04 13:44:25
267人看过
筛选功能是表格处理软件中极为重要的数据处理工具,它允许用户根据特定条件从庞大数据集中快速提取所需信息。本文将系统阐述筛选操作的核心逻辑,即明确“筛选什么内容”以及“将结果放置在何处”。内容涵盖基础的单条件筛选、进阶的多条件与自定义筛选,并深入探讨如何将筛选结果输出到指定工作表或区域,旨在为用户提供一套清晰、高效的数据处理工作流。
2026-01-04 13:44:15
379人看过
电子表格软件中的加法运算看似简单,却暗藏诸多陷阱。本文系统剖析其十二大核心问题,包括浮点精度误差、隐性格式转换、空值处理异常等底层机制缺陷,并结合实际场景提供专业解决方案,帮助用户从根本上规避计算风险。
2026-01-04 13:44:07
282人看过
焊接喇叭是一项融合了细致手工与基础电子技术的实用技能,无论是维修旧音箱还是DIY新设备都不可或缺。本文将以超过四千字的详尽篇幅,系统性地为您解析从工具准备、焊锡选择到具体焊接操作与安全检测的全流程。内容将深入探讨十二个关键环节,包括如何区分喇叭音盆引线材质、选择合适功率的电烙铁、以及避免虚焊和过热损伤音圈等核心技巧。文章旨在为初学者和爱好者提供一份权威、易懂且能立即上手的实操指南,帮助您高质量地完成喇叭焊接工作。
2026-01-04 13:43:58
123人看过
热门推荐
资讯中心:
.webp)



.webp)
.webp)